Mercurial > hg > octave-kai > gnulib-hg
annotate modules/readlink-tests @ 12059:6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
readlink("link/",buf,len) mistakenly succeeded.
* lib/readlink.c (rpl_readlink): Work around trailing slash bug.
* m4/readlink.m4 (gl_FUNC_READLINK): Detect the bug.
* doc/posix-functions/readlink.texi (readlink): Document this.
* modules/readlink-tests: New test.
* tests/test-readlink.c: Likewise.
Signed-off-by: Eric Blake <ebb9@byu.net>
author | Eric Blake <ebb9@byu.net> |
---|---|
date | Tue, 22 Sep 2009 17:15:04 -0600 |
parents | |
children | c47da311af77 |
rev | line source |
---|---|
12059
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
1 Files: |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
2 tests/test-readlink.c |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
3 |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
4 Depends-on: |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
5 symlink |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
6 |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
7 configure.ac: |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
8 |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
9 Makefile.am: |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
10 TESTS += test-readlink |
6babf16a67dd
readlink: fix Solaris 9 bug with trailing slash
Eric Blake <ebb9@byu.net>
parents:
diff
changeset
|
11 check_PROGRAMS += test-readlink |